The Real Cost Behind 145 Spins

When Levelup Casino promises 145 free spins, they’re really offering 145 chances to lose a bet of AU$0.10 each, which totals AU$14.50 in stake exposure. Compare that to a single AU$10 bet on Starburst that could pay out 50× the stake – you’d need 0.29 of those spins to equal the same risk. And the “free” label is a marketing ploy, not a charity. “Free” spins cost the casino no cash, but they cost you a fraction of your bankroll in wagering requirements that can be as high as 30× the spin value. That means you must wager AU$435 (30 × AU$14.50) before you see any real money, a figure most players overlook while scrolling through flashy banners.

How Wagering Requirements Skew the Odds

Imagine you hit a 100× multiplier on Gonzo’s Quest during a free spin. The raw payout looks sexy: AU$1,450 from a AU$14.50 stake. Yet the 30× wagering condition forces you to play another AU$435 worth of bets, where the average RTP of Gonzo’s Quest sits at 96.3%, leaving you with an expected loss of AU$16.15 after the required playthrough. PlayAmo uses a similar 25× condition on their welcome offers, effectively turning a bright win into a modest net loss.

Because the casino sets a maximum cashout of AU$100 on free‑spin winnings, any payout exceeding that cap is trimmed, turning a theoretical AU$500 win into a flat AU$100. That cap alone reduces the expected value by 80% for high‑volatility games like Dead or Alive 2. The house edge climbs from 2.7% to roughly 10% once you factor in the cap.

  • 145 spins × AU$0.10 = AU$14.50 exposure
  • 30× wagering = AU$435 required play
  • Maximum cashout = AU$100 limit
